Isotype Controls

Cell typing with monoclonal antibodies to CD antigens in flow cytometry or other immunological applications can give false positives in the absence of proper controls. Sigma recommends using a non-reactive immunoglobulin of the same isotype and concentration to detect non-specific binding.
